TPNT KGWC 050910
A. TROPICAL DEPRESSION TWO
B. 05/0815Z (52)
C. XX.X
D. XXX.X
E. GOES12
F. TX.X/2.0 -05/0815Z-
G. IR/EIR

LLCC COULD NOT BE FOUND. THIS WILL BE THE LAST BULLETIN FROM AFWA
ON THIS SYSTEM. AREA WILL BE MONITORED FOR SIGNS OF REGENERATION.

PERALES


TPNT KGWC 050612
A. HURRICANE ALEX (ONE)
B. 05/0515Z (50)
C. 39.3N/5
D. 63.5W/4
E. ONE/GOES12
F. T5.5/5.5/D1.5/24HRS -05/0515Z-
G. IR/EIR

01A/PBO 30NM RND EYE/ANMTN. WMG EYE SURROUNDED BY 29NM LG
RNG YIELDS AN EYE NUMBER OF 5.0. ADDED 0.5 FOR EYE ADJUSTMENT
TO YIELD A DT OF 5.5. FT BASED ON DT. PT AND MET AGREE.

AODT: 5.5 (CLEAR EYE)

PERALES
